Ana María Camacho

Prof. Ana María Camacho

Construction and Manufacturing Engineering,  UNED

My main research field is Materials Technology and Manufacturing Engineering, especially focusing on the analysis of metal and plastic forming and additive manufacturing processes through computer-aided engineering tools, analytical methods, and experimental testing. Nowadays, I am working on the study of phenomena such as damage and friction in the efficiency and formability of metal-forming processes; the analysis of the influence of process parameters in the performance of parts produced via additive manufacturing techniques such as FDM (fused deposition modelling) and WAAM (wire and arc additive manufacturing); and the development of methodologies for material selection in the manufacturing of components for demanding applications. I belong to the Research Group of the UNED "Industrial Production and Manufacturing Engineering-(IPME).
